Mezcal Hot Chocolate
Mezcal Hot Chocolate - .25 ounce Mezcal
- 5 ounces European Hot Chocolate
- Pour in the mezcal into your favorite mug.
- Top with your hot chocolate.
- Slight stir to incorporate the ingredients.

Apple Pie Flip
Apple Pie Flip - 1.5 ounces Apple Brandy
- .5 ounce 100 Proof Rye Whiskey
- 1 ounce Chai Tea
- 1 Full Egg
- Add ice to a
coupe orNick and Nora glass. This will help keep your
cocktail colder, longer. - Combine all your ingredients into a cocktail shaker tin.
- Dry shake for 8 – 10 seconds.
- Add ice to your tin.
- Shake for 12 – 15 seconds.
- Dump out ice from your cocktail glass.
- Double strain your drink into your glass.
- Grate fresh nutmeg on the top of your cocktail.

Pomegranate Gin Mule
Pomegranate Gin Mule - 2 ounces Tanqueray Gin
- .75 ounce Pomegranate Juice
- .5 ounce Honey Syrup (2:1)
- 4 oz Ginger Beer
- Combine gin, pomegranate juice, and honey syrup into a shaker tin.
- Add ice.
- Shake for 5 – 8 seconds. Only looking to incorporate and not diluting a
lot. - Strain over ice in your mule mug.
- Top off with ginger beer.
- Garnish with a lime wedge.
